Texas Spice Rack (Tenaha, Texas)

Texas Spice Rack Contact Details

Find Texas Spice Rack Location, Phone Number, Business Hours, and Service Offerings.

Name:
Texas Spice Rack
Phone Number:
(936) 248-2075
Location:
307 S George Bowers Dr, Tenaha, TX 75974
Business Hours:
Mon - Fri 9:00 am - 5:00 pm
Service Offerings:
Herbs

Texas Spice Rack Driving Directions

Get directions to Texas Spice Rack and view location on map.


Nearby Herb Shops

Gnc 1711 E End Blvd N Ste 600 Marshall, 75670